Assisted Living Costs in Wake Forest, North Carolina
When considering the transition to assisted living, understanding the associated costs is crucial for families and individuals. In Wake Forest, North Carolina, the financial aspect of assisted living is an important consideration. The area is known for its serene environment and proximity to reputable medical facilities such as Duke Health Raleigh Hospital and Rex Hospital, which can offer peace of mind to residents requiring occasional medical attention.
The cost of assisted living in this region reflects the quality of care and amenities provided. According to long-term care financial company Genworth, the average cost of assisted living in North Carolina stands at $5,769 per month. However, in Wake Forest, the average monthly cost is notably higher, approximately $7,020. This figure can vary depending on the level of care and the type of facility chosen.
For those concerned about managing these costs, it's important to explore available government support programs. In Wake Forest, residents may have access to various options that can help offset the expenses. Programs such as Medicaid and other state-specific initiatives can provide financial assistance to those who qualify, ensuring that assisted living is a viable option for a wider range of individuals.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Wake Forest, North Carolina
When considering long-term care options for yourself or a loved one, it's important to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ities. Each type of care caters to diverse needs and offers varying levels of support.
Assisted Living facilities in Wake Forest provide a balance between independence and assistance. Residents live in private or semi-private apartments and receive help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These communities often offer social activities, meals, and transportation services, making them ideal for individuals who require some support but still maintain a degree of autonomy.
Memory Care is a specialized form of assisted living designed specifically for individuals with Alzheimer's, dementia, or other memory impairments. These facilities provide a secure environment with structured activities and routines to help residents maintain their cognitive abilities. Staff are trained to handle the unique challenges associated with memory loss, ensuring a compassionate and understanding approach to care.
Nursing Homes, also known as skilled nursing facilities, offer the highest level of care outside of a hospital. They provide 24-hour medical attention and support for residents with serious health conditions who require constant monitoring. The services include wound care, rehabilitation, and various therapies. Nursing homes are suited for those with significant healthcare needs and who cannot be adequately cared for in a less intensive setting.
Independent Living communities cater to seniors who are still active and require little to no assistance with daily living. These facilities offer private housing, amenities such as fitness centers, and community events, promoting a lifestyle of leisure and social engagement.
In Wake Forest, North Carolina, each type of facility offers a unique blend of services, amenities, and care levels to match the specific needs of the individual. When making a decision, consider the current and future needs of the residents to ensure they receive the appropriate level of care and support.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Wake Forest, North Carolina
Qualifying for assisted living in Wake Forest, North Carolina, involves a combination of personal needs, financial considerations, and meeting specific state and facility requirements. Assisted living is designed for individuals who require assistance with daily activities but do not need the full-time health care services provided by a nursing home.
To qualify for assisted living in Wake Forest, one must typically demonstrate a level of functional impairment that necessitates assistance with activities such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and mobility. The evaluation process often includes a health assessment by a medical professional and care needs assessment conducted by the assisted living facility.
Financially, residents are usually required to pay for the costs of care out of pocket, through long-term care insurance, or with the help of government programs. In North Carolina, Medicaid offers the Personal Care Services (PCS) program, which may cover some of the services provided in assisted living for those who qualify. Additionally, the Special Assistance program is a state-funded resource that can help eligible residents with the monthly costs associated with assisted living.
To determine eligibility for these programs, individuals must meet certain income and asset criteria, which are subject to change and should be verified with the appropriate state agencies. It's advisable to consult with a financial advisor or an elder law attorney who is knowledgeable about North Carolina's specific programs and can provide guidance on how to navigate the financial requirements for assisted living.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Wake Forest, North Carolina
Assisted living facilities offer a blend of independence and assistance that caters to the varying needs of seniors. In Wake Forest, North Carolina, these communities provide an array of services designed to support the elderly while respecting their autonomy. However, as with any major life decision, there are pros and cons to consider.
One of the primary advantages of assisted living in Wake Forest is the quality of care available. Facilities in this region are known for their well-trained staff and comprehensive care plans tailored to individual needs. Seniors can receive help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management while still enjoying a sense of independence.
Another benefit is the social environment. Assisted living communities in Wake Forest often offer a full calendar of activities and events, encouraging residents to engage with their peers and avoid the isolation that can occur with aging. Additionally, the temperate climate and charming scenery of North Carolina provide a serene backdrop for seniors to enjoy their retirement.
However, the cost can be a significant disadvantage. Assisted living in Wake Forest can be expensive, with prices varying based on the level of care required and the luxury of the facility. While some seniors may have saved enough to cover these costs, others might find it financially challenging.
Lastly, while assisted living offers a level of care, it may not be sufficient for those with advanced medical needs. In such cases, a nursing home or specialized care facility might be more appropriate, which can be a difficult transition for some seniors and their families.
In summary, assisted living in Wake Forest, North Carolina, offers a supportive community with excellent care but requires careful financial planning and may not suit everyone’s healthcare needs. Seniors and their loved ones need to weigh these factors to make the best choice for their situation.
